BTS Surpasses 2 Million 1st-Day Album Sales With Anthology Album "Proof" Music Jun 10, 2022 by Sarah Cho BTS has once again become a double-million seller in just one day!
On June 10, BTS released their new anthology album “Proof” at 1 p.m. KST. According to Hanteo Chart, by 9 p.m. KST the same day, the group had sold over 2.15 million copies.
What’s especially notable about this achievement is that it isn’t far off from BTS’s second-highest first-week sales record of 2.27 million copies, which they achieved with their latest album “BE (Deluxe Edition).” This record is bested only by BTS’s “Map of the Soul: 7,” which sold 3.3 million copies in its first week.
After first becoming million sellers in 2016 with their second full album “WINGS,” BTS has consistently sold over 1.13 million copies with each of their albums over the past six years.
BTS’s latest anthology album “Proof” features a compilation of the group’s past title tracks, various solo and unit songs, demo versions, unreleased songs, as well as three new tracks, “Yet To Come (The Most Beautiful Moment),” “Run BTS,” and “For Youth.”
